Flipkart Bolsters Supply Chain Capacity for Upcoming Festive Season

As the festive season approaches, Flipkart, India’s leading e-commerce platform, is gearing up to meet the surge in demand by fortifying its supply chain infrastructure. With the addition of new fulfillment centers and last-mile hubs in various cities, Flipkart is set to expand its reach to over 21,000 pincodes across the country. This strategic expansion comes at a crucial time when e-commerce companies are bracing themselves for the annual festive shopping frenzy.

One of the key highlights of Flipkart’s supply chain enhancement is the establishment of a regional distribution center in Manesar. This new facility will play a pivotal role in streamlining the storage and distribution of products, ensuring quicker order fulfillment and delivery to customers. Additionally, Flipkart is also venturing into the grocery segment by setting up a dedicated center in Agartala to cater to the rising demand for online grocery shopping.

In line with its commitment to fostering economic growth and inclusivity, Flipkart’s expansion drive is expected to create over 2.2 lakh seasonal job opportunities. By ramping up its workforce, especially during peak seasons, Flipkart is not only addressing the surge in demand but also providing livelihood opportunities to a large number of individuals across the country.
